Diddy and Ma$e’s beef goes again almost twenty years, however just lately resurfaced. In 2020, Ma$e claimed Diddy refused to simply accept his $2 million supply to purchase again his publishing. The “Really feel So Good” rapper has seemingly been on Puff’s helmet ever since. Earlier this yr, Ma$e put out the Diddy diss “Oracle 2: Standing on Our bodies.” He adopted up with a rant about how Diddy was ruining his artists’ lives.
